]> git.armaanb.net Git - opendoas.git/commitdiff
Oops, CVS mismerged changes, resulting in compilable and mostly working,
authorVadim Zhukov <zhuk@openbsd.org>
Sun, 26 Jul 2015 19:49:11 +0000 (19:49 +0000)
committerVadim Zhukov <zhuk@openbsd.org>
Sun, 26 Jul 2015 19:49:11 +0000 (19:49 +0000)
but somewhat wrong code. Well, the CVS mismerged but I just missed.

doas.c

diff --git a/doas.c b/doas.c
index be48957753e0b86992341573886cdb5c58b442b9..fb571e6db1640c9430e69cb5b861be6fb967c524 100644 (file)
--- a/doas.c
+++ b/doas.c
@@ -1,4 +1,4 @@
-/* $OpenBSD: doas.c,v 1.23 2015/07/26 19:08:17 zhuk Exp $ */
+/* $OpenBSD: doas.c,v 1.24 2015/07/26 19:14:46 tedu Exp $ */
 /*
  * Copyright (c) 2015 Ted Unangst <tedu@openbsd.org>
  *
@@ -379,9 +379,7 @@ main(int argc, char **argv, char **envp)
        parseconfig("/etc/doas.conf", 1);
 
        /* cmdline is used only for logging, no need to abort on truncate */
-       (void) strlcpy(cmdline, argv[0], sizeof(cmdline)) < sizeof(cmdline);
-       if (strlcpy(cmdline, argv[0], sizeof(cmdline)) >= sizeof(cmdline))
-               errx(1, "command line too long");
+       (void) strlcpy(cmdline, argv[0], sizeof(cmdline));
        for (i = 1; i < argc; i++) {
                if (strlcat(cmdline, " ", sizeof(cmdline)) >= sizeof(cmdline))
                        break;